Transaction 7043accdfb104f71044fe87ff58365a28bca044b2ddc6feb7c62c31fad240d28
1 Input
2 Outputs
- 7043accdfb104f71044fe87ff58365a28bca044b2ddc6feb7c62c31fad240d28:0
- 7043accdfb104f71044fe87ff58365a28bca044b2ddc6feb7c62c31fad240d28:1
value 481129
address 1MJJHozLbKpZxbhXaYcL6gibAE7zZKoUXa
value 1077768
address 1AVNCUwtF7ki7K4rWC9ka3VAoQEneWDwcL